BAL mainly for me, although i've also used webber, granfix and more recently mainly profix which i think is good value for money
 
I have used a lot more Mapei this year......didn't realise how good a product it was....😛unk::drool5:
 
I've been using Palace gear (it's bagged up as Excel Bond at Tile Clearing House stores) and to be honest it's dirt cheap and does what it's supposed to do.

I don't understand why some traders would spend £25.99 on a BAL product when at a Tile Clearing House you can get the same stuff for £13.50!!

My local one in Orpington, Kent has just started selling a slow-set white powder adhesive for walls and floors, interior and exterior, for £12.99 a 20kg bag. Can anyone beat that??

Bal - over rated and def over priced
 
BAL for me everytime. Some may say it's overpriced but you're not just buying a bag of adhesive, your paying for tech support (which for example Profix / Dunlop don't offer to the same extent) and piece of mind.

You pay's your money, you gets your product and you walk of a job with a bit more piece of mind :yesnod:.
